Army Corps Project Briefing Bill
Official: Army Corps Congressional Engagement Act
This bill makes sure that the Army Corps of Engineers regularly updates Congress about local projects they are working on. It helps keep lawmakers informed about project progress and community impacts.
1. This bill requires annual briefings from the Army Corps of Engineers to Congress members. 2. The briefings will cover projects in specific congressional districts funded by the Corps. 3. Each briefing will include project status, funding details, and community impacts. 4. If a briefing is missed, the District Commander must explain why and plan to reschedule. 5. The bill aims to improve communication between the Corps and Congress about local projects.
Members of Congress and their constituents in areas with Corps of Engineers projects will be directly affected.
